> >>>>Hello,
> >>>>
> >>>>I posted this to the general list this morning & got a couple of good
leads, but they weren't able to actually fix the problem, so I'm posting
here to the db list.
> >>>>
> >>>>I'm making some headway on joining three MySQL tables.
> >>>>
> >>>>However, when I run this query:
> >>>>
> >>>>mysql_query("SELECT
> >>>>     WLPbib.bibID,
> >>>>        WLPbib.title,
> >>>>        WLPbib.publisher,
> >>>>        WLPbib.publicationDate,
> >>>>        WLPaddress.city,
> >>>>        WLPaddress.state,
> >>>>        WLPprofile.firstName,
> >>>>        WLPprofile.lastName,
> >>>>        WLPprofile.organization,
> >>>>        WLPcountry.languageName
> >>>>
> >>>>FROM      WLPbib
> >>>
> >>>>        LEFT JOIN WLPprofile ON WLPprofile.profileID =
WLPbib.profileID
> >>>>        LEFT JOIN WLPaddress ON WLPaddress.publisherID =
WLPbib.publisherID
> >>>>        LEFT JOIN WLPcountry ON WLPcountry.countryID =
WLPaddress.countryID");
> >>>>
> >>>>I now get results in triplicate.  ie. I'm getting three copies of the
same title, firstName, organization, etc....
> >>>>
> >>>>I somehow suspected that this should be the result with LEFT JOIN, but
I'm not sure how to return a query without duplication.
> >>>>
> >>>>This is far better than what I had this morning (which was no response
from the server).
> >>>>
> >>>>Thanks.  I'm new to joining tables...
> >>>>
> >>>>Someone wrote back suggesting that SELECT DISTINCT could be used to to
the job.
> >>>>
> >>>>Another person suggested that using UNIQUE(profileID) would make it
look nicer.  I wasn't sure how to use UNIQUE with the last JOIN as it isn't
directly linked to WLPbib..
> >>>>
> >>>>Any suggestions would be useful.
